Things We Saw Today: Happy Birthday, Peter Parker!

Peter Parker's passport in Spider-Man: Far From Home, showing his birthday as August 10.

Peter Parker has gone through a lot in his 59 years of being. His first comic appearance came in 1962, and since, we’ve all fallen in love with the boy from Queens and his ability to scale walls and swing from New York City skyscrapers. Thanks to Spider-Man: Far From Home, we know that Peter Parker’s birthday (in the Marvel Cinematic Universe, at least) is on August 10, and so today, we’re celebrating the friendly neighborhood Spider-Man!
